What are the best libertarian political blogs?
What are the best and most popular libertarian political blogs on the internet?

Greetings -- I hope I can help you out with finding a good Libertarian blog that piques your interest!
First, I found a catalogue of Libertarian political blogs. Unfortunately, these aren’t currently ranked or scored, although there seems to be the capability to give each blog a star rating. The catalogue can be found at http://www.blogcatalog.com/category/politics/libertarian/.
Again, although this listing is not ranked (rather, it is done alphabetically) and the post is quite dated (from 2005), this list of Libertarian blogs might give you a good starting point in your search for a blog you find interesting and inline with your own political views. This list, which contains 14 blogs, can be found at http://politicalbloglistings.blogspot.com/2005/01/libertarian-blogs-alphabetical.html. Unfortunately, some of the links are dead, but the active ones link to blogs that are frequently updated and quite extensive.
Lastly, I present to you the most likely resource to be helpful in your search for a good Libertarian blog. The website was published in 2009, so it’s fairly recent, and the list is a ranking of the top 100 best Libertarian blogs. It’s important to note that the list, in and of itself, is not ranked -- like number 1 is not the author’s best and favorite blog -- but the list is a collection of the best and top rated blogs, if that makes sense. To view the list, please visit http://www.humblelibertarian.com/2009/03/top-100-libertarian-blogs-and-websites.html.
I hope you found these 3 resources helpful in your search for a good Libertarian political blog.
